Nah, they wouldn't do that. State inheritance tax may (still) be deductible from federal gross income, though. That's the only way I can think of that the IRS would know anything about it. If you misreported something the IRS might become aware of your error & come calling for additional income or estate tax. In theory, anyway.

If the amount your mom gave away as gifts during her lifetime, plus the size of her estate at death, is over roughly $11,000,000, she'd have owed estate tax. If that didn't get paid properly, there are ways the IRS could come calling. Looking for estate tax, not inheritance tax, but it would be a confusing situation.

There is no federal inheritance tax. The IRS would not send you or anyone else in the entire universe a letter having anything to do with inheritance tax. It does not exist.

There is a federal estate tax but it's a different thing paid by the estate (not you) and it's very unlikely any was due to begin with.
